[jira] [Created] (JENA-657) Integrate result set parsing into RIOT properly

Currently the result set parsing and writing APIs are somewhat messy and arbitrary.  They don't follow a consistent interface or share any common implementation and there is very limited registry support.

For example wherever we decide how to parse SPARQL results we typically end up writing complex {{if(contentType.equals(CONSTANT))}} type statements.

It would be better if there was a consistent interface for results parser and a proper registry a la {{RDFLanguages}} so we can more easily work with results.
